Palestinian child suffers stroke, is saved at Jerusalem hospital – A child suffering a stroke is a rare case, with an incidence of one in half-a-million children. | The Jerusalem Post
A four-year-old girl named Ayla who lives in the West Bank town of Kalkilya suffered during the past year from repeated brain events that caused paralysis and life-threatening symptoms. No hospitals in the territories were able to diagnose her condition correctly.
